How much does a preschool teacher earn in Lakewood, OH?

The average preschool teacher in Lakewood, OH earns between $20,000 and $40,000 annually. This compares to the national average preschool teacher range of $23,000 to $47,000.

Average preschool teacher salary in Lakewood, OH

$28,000
